三层交换划分vlan,dhcp分配地址,vlan间隔离
时间: 2024-08-15 19:08:05 浏览: 23
三层交换机是一种在网络架构中结合了二层交换和三层路由功能的设备。当涉及到VLAN (虚拟局域网) 分割时,三层交换机可以按需创建多个独立的逻辑网络。每个VLAN代表一个单独的广播域,能有效隔离不同部门或服务之间的通信,增强网络安全。
DHCP (Dynamic Host Configuration Protocol) 是一种自动分配IP地址的服务。在三层交换环境下,当一台新的设备接入网络时,DHCP服务器会动态地为其分配一个可用的IP地址、子网掩码、默认网关等信息,使得设备能够自动配置其网络设置并连接到正确的网络VLAN。
三层交换机通过路由表进行管理,不同VLAN间的通信需要通过路由器或者三层交换机的路由功能,因为它们理解不同VLAN之间的逻辑路径。这样,尽管物理上相连,但通过VLAN标签,流量可以在不同VLAN之间进行安全传输,实现真正的逻辑隔离。
相关问题
使用三层交换配置DHCP为不同VLAN分配IP地址
首先,需要在三层交换机上创建不同的VLAN。假设我们创建了VLAN10和VLAN20,分别对应不同的子网。接下来,需要配置DHCP服务器来为这些子网分配IP地址。
1. 配置VLAN
```
switch(config)# vlan 10
switch(config-vlan)# name vlan10
switch(config-vlan)# exit
switch(config)# vlan 20
switch(config-vlan)# name vlan20
switch(config-vlan)# exit
```
2. 配置接口
为每个VLAN配置一个接口,并将接口与相应的VLAN关联。
```
switch(config)# interface vlan 10
switch(config-if)# ip address 10.0.0.1 255.255.255.0
switch(config-if)# no shutdown
switch(config-if)# exit
switch(config)# interface vlan 20
switch(config-if)# ip address 20.0.0.1 255.255.255.0
switch(config-if)# no shutdown
switch(config-if)# exit
```
3. 配置DHCP
为每个子网配置一个DHCP池,并将DHCP池与相应的VLAN关联。
```
switch(config)# ip dhcp pool vlan10
switch(dhcp-config)# network 10.0.0.0 255.255.255.0
switch(dhcp-config)# default-router 10.0.0.1
switch(dhcp-config)# exit
switch(config)# ip dhcp pool vlan20
switch(dhcp-config)# network 20.0.0.0 255.255.255.0
switch(dhcp-config)# default-router 20.0.0.1
switch(dhcp-config)# exit
```
4. 配置交换机端口
将交换机端口与相应的VLAN关联,以便可以将DHCP分配的IP地址分配给正确的设备。
```
switch(config)# interface GigabitEthernet 1/0/1
switch(config-if)# switchport mode access
switch(config-if)# switchport access vlan 10
switch(config-if)# exit
switch(config)# interface GigabitEthernet 1/0/2
switch(config-if)# switchport mode access
switch(config-if)# switchport access vlan 20
switch(config-if)# exit
```
这样配置后,设备连接到端口1/0/1将获得VLAN10中的IP地址,而设备连接到端口1/0/2将获得VLAN20中的IP地址。
dhcp三层交换机vlan间通信
DHCP(Dynamic Host Configuration Protocol)是一种网络协议,用于自动分配IP地址和其他网络配置信息给网络中的设备。三层交换机是指能够在网络层(第三层)进行数据转发和路由的交换机。VLAN(Virtual Local Area Network)是一种虚拟局域网技术,可以将一个物理局域网划分为多个逻辑上的虚拟局域网。
在三层交换机中,不同VLAN之间的通信需要通过路由器来实现。而DHCP服务器通常位于某个特定的VLAN中,为该VLAN中的设备提供IP地址和其他网络配置信息。因此,如果需要实现不同VLAN之间的DHCP通信,需要进行以下步骤:
1. 配置三层交换机的接口:将不同VLAN对应的接口配置为三层接口,并分配IP地址。
2. 配置VLAN间的路由:在三层交换机上配置静态路由或动态路由协议,以实现不同VLAN之间的路由功能。
3. 配置DHCP Relay(中继):在三层交换机上启用DHCP Relay功能,并指定DHCP服务器的IP地址。这样,当设备在一个VLAN中发送DHCP请求时,三层交换机会将该请求转发给指定的DHCP服务器。
4. 配置DHCP服务器:在DHCP服务器上配置相应的IP地址池和其他网络配置信息,以响应来自不同VLAN的DHCP请求。
通过以上步骤,不同VLAN中的设备就可以通过三层交换机进行DHCP通信了。